Rotary indexers are critical automation components used to precisely position workpieces, tools, and assemblies during manufacturing processes. These systems enable accurate indexing, repetitive motion control, and high-speed positioning, making them essential in industries such as automotive, electronics, packaging, aerospace, medical devices, and industrial machinery. By improving precision and operational efficiency, rotary indexers help manufacturers enhance productivity while maintaining consistent product quality.
